== Old English ==
=== Alternative forms ===
bispel, bīspel, bigspel, biġspel
=== Etymology ===
From bī- (“by”) + spell (“story, news”). More at bī-, spell. Compare Old Armenian առասպել (aṙaspel).
=== Pronunciation ===
IPA(key): /ˈbiːˌspell/, [ˈbiːˌspeɫ]
=== Noun ===
bīspell n
example, pattern; proverb
Homilies of the Anglo-Saxon Church
parable, story, fable, allegory
